    HACKENSACK, NJ - The city introduced an ordinance to institute a "Memorial Tree Program" whereby citizens can donate a tree to the city in memory of loved ones.

    On May 21, the city council amended its Parks ordinance, adding the section "Memorial Tree Program".

    Those wishing to do so can place a plaque at the tree by applying through the Department of Public Works at a location on a first-come, first-served basis. The fee for a tree and plaque dedication shall be $450.

    The DPW will coordinate the preparation and installation of each tree and plaque. The size, species, style and material of the tree and plaque will also be determined by the city.

    Applicants will be responsible for any trees or plaques to do vandalism or acts of mother nature.

    This ordinance will be considered for final passage after a public hearing on June 11 at city hall, 8 p.m.
